1、下载并解压OpenCV 下载到的文件名为“OpenCV-2.3.1-win-superpack.exe”,解压到任意一个文件夹,比如“D:\project_C_Plus”。 2、设置环境变量 OpenCV库函数需要通过用户环境变量调用所需要的库文件。点击:开始->计算机(右击)->属性->高级系统设置->高级->环境变量,在用户变量里增加一项: 变量名:path 变量...
【源代码】使用OpenCV库来实时显示并拍照两个网络摄像头的视频流增加刷新/停止 import cv2 import threading import time import datetime from PyQt5.QtWidgets import * from PyQt5.QtCore import * from PyQt5.QtGui import * import os from onvifCameroTest import get_onvif_device_info #测试摄像头的URL是...
【使用OpenCV库来实时显示并拍照两个网络摄像头的视频流【利用多线程提高视频流畅度】】 https://www.bilibili.com/video/BV1Rf421q7it/?share_source=copy_web&vd_source=9a7768a01ea4de47cab388a63203d454 import cv2 import tkinter as tk from tkinter import ttk import threading import time import datetime...
#include <opencv2/opencv.hpp>usingnamespacecv;usingnamespacestd;#defineWINDOW_NAME1 "【原始图窗口】"VideoCapture capture;//注意:多维同时控制需要相机和intsaturation =60;intGamma =72;intlight =50;voidonSaturationChange(int,void*){ capture.set(CAP_PROP_SATURATION, saturation); }voidonGammaChange(i...
51CTO博客已为您找到关于opencv多线程读取视频流并显示的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及opencv多线程读取视频流并显示问答内容。更多opencv多线程读取视频流并显示相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
要在QML中显示OpenCV通过VideoCapture获取的本地摄像头实时视频流,可以使用Qt的QQuickPaintedItem来将OpenCV图像渲染到QML中。具体步骤如下: 在项目文件中添加QT += widgets,以便使用QtWidgets库。 创建一个继承自QQuickPaintedItem的类,并在该类中实现需要渲染的图像。
视频流中出现了一个矩形,找到“最大目标区域”,并分屏显示出来了。左上为原始的视频,右上为“最大目标区域”,下方的视频也是“最大目标区域” 以下是python 代码: importcv2importnumpyasnp widthImg =640heightImg =480cap = cv2.VideoCapture(0)
尝试链接 PyQt 和 Opencv 视频提要,无法理解如何应用 while 循环连续播放视频。它只是拍一张静态照片。请任何人帮助解决问题。 PtQt=5 Python=3.6.1 class App(QWidget): def __init__(self): super().__init__() self.title = 'PyQt5 Video' self.left = 100 self.top = 100 self.width = 640 ...
PyQt显示来自opencv的视频流 尝试链接PyQt和Opencv视频源,无法理解如何应用while循环连续流式传输视频。它只需要一张照片。请任何人都可以帮助解决问题。 PtQt = 5 蟒蛇= 3.6.1 class App(QWidget): def __init__(self): super().__init__() self.title = 'PyQt5 Video' self.left = 100 self.top =...
我做了类似的事情,这是我的代码,但这是硬编码的,只有6个摄像头。